Dan Bowditch has forty-five years of experience in utility engineering, operations and senior management including twenty years of information technology senior and executive management. Dan has excellent communication, organizational and interpersonal skills with a reputation for high integrity and solid team leadership. He has earned the respect of utility executives through direct working relationships and through his volunteer work in the international Geospatial Information and Technology Association which honoured him with the GITA Distinguished Service Award in 2010. For many years, Dan has chaired the volunteer board of the Rogue Folk Club, a vibrant local community arts organization. More recently, Dan has turned his attention to volunteer work as a partner with Social Venture Partners Vancouver, a venture philanthropy organization investing money, time and expertise in capacity building for non-profits helping vulnerable youth. He has been recognized with the 2015 UBC Engineering Community Leadership Award and a UBC Faculty of Applied Science Dean's Medal of Distinction in 2016. Dan lives in North Vancouver, Canada with his wife Ursula.
